META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

4,695 of the 7,461 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Meta Platforms (Facebook) (META)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$966B — down 2.7% from $993B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 275 funds opened new META positions and 146 closed out — a net gain of 129 holders — while 2,263 added to existing stakes and 1,760 trimmed.

The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$4.2B. The largest seller was Nuveen, cutting an estimated $5.72B.
